    Hi, probably seen a topic similar to this but this isn't about which is better more like a clarification question. I was looking pros and cons of each and how they are different and did some job searching to see what the available jobs look like, using a website called glassdoor i searched computer science jobs and a lot of job opportunities came up but a lot of them for the title said Software Engineer. I've noticed that seems to be a common thing, so my question is even tho im looking for computer science jobs would the title of the job be called Software Engineer? Or are those supposed to be jobs more geared toward people with a Software Engineer degree? i know they are very similar and can almost be interchangeable but i just wasn't sure about this.     Software engineering jobs focus more on development while computer science jobs can also focus on academic research. As for degrees go, with a computer science degree you would be able to do both of these jobs but with a software engineering degree you wouldn't be able to take on every computer science job.
